There are a number of accessories you might like to consider if you are going to become a coffee connoisseur and begin brewing that perfect cup of coffee at home. First off you are going to need a grinder to get the freshest ground beans available. You will want some filters to fit the coffee maker that you have and you may even want to add a water filter to make sure you get out all of those imperfections that could alter the taste. Then of course the most important of coffee maker accessories is the mug. Make sure to get yourself that one unique coffee mug and you will have most of the necessities of making the perfect cup of coffee. Oh, and don't forget the cleaner as nothing makes coffee taste worse than having old residue hanging around the internals of your pot. Of course, depending on your coffee maker you could add additional coffee making accessories as well.

Krups

If you have a Krups brand maker then you may wish to buy their special supplies. Krups coffee maker accessories include a Krups water filter that will help eliminate mineral deposits as well as remove chlorine and other chemical that may be in your water, and their own decanters and carafes which have the dual purpose of being serving pictures and at the same time keeping the coffee hot for extended periods of time. You can get these items as well as their grinders on line and in stores.

Hamilton Beach

Hamilton Beach coffee maker accessories include a permanent filter and you can get replacements for the water filter system as well. They offer filters and carafes in stainless steel, they do not add any taste and are safe to put in the dishwasher.

Delonghi

Delonghi coffee maker accessories are more in the line of coffee types, and maybe some flavoring as well as the mug and carafe as these coffee centers are all inclusive and even have a built in grinder. Though the price tag is much higher with the Delonghi coffee centers you will have an espresso machine as well and you will be able to make a much wider range of coffee beverages.

Braun

When purchasing Braun coffee maker accessories you will have to consider the Braun univ gold screen reusable filter as well as the Braun Brita water filter as they were developed especially for their products.

Cuisinart

A charcoal water filter would be among the Cuisinart coffee maker parts and accessories that you would need to consider.   Cuisinart coffee maker accessories offer a wide variety of carafes, grinders and the like.

Water

To be sure no matter what type of coffee maker that you own you will want to have everything that you need when you get started making that move to coffee connoisseur. Just keep in mind that the purer the water is the better tasting the end product will be. When you use filtered water and some of the better permanent basket filters you may have to adjust the amount of coffee that you use until you get that perfect taste.
